Output d66ead6a2b9ca12b47391c0f15c804754d397df631f732bc8300d04655bc3b5e:31

value
858955
script pubkey
OP_0 OP_PUSHBYTES_20 188c6c2a3e16d90452f95ebc1b521b13d692681c
address
bc1qrzxxc237zmvsg5het67pk5smz0tfy6qujzqqzt
transaction
d66ead6a2b9ca12b47391c0f15c804754d397df631f732bc8300d04655bc3b5e
spent
true